What sides can you eat on keto? (When ordering!)

Hitting the town and not sure what to order? Your best low carb bet will be a side salad or roasted/sauteed/steamed veggies. Avoid coleslaw, or vegetables tossed in sauce — often sugar is added to make them more cravable. For a full breakdown, check out myguide to keto restaurants for all the lowest carb orders.

Ingredients

  • 1 Large Onion cut into 1/4-inch slices
  • Frying Oil (see notes below) (enough to fill your pan with 1" of oil)
  • 1 Cup Whey Protein Isolate
  • 2 Teaspoon Xanthan Gum
  • 1 1/2 Teaspoon Kosher Salt
  • 2 Teaspoon Baking Powder
  • 1/2 Cup Parmesan grated
  • 6 Tablespoons Soda Water
  • 1 Egg whisked

US Customary - Metric

Instructions

  • Heat 1" of oil on high in a heavy bottom pan (I use a skillet). I like to use a smaller pan for this so I don't need as much oil. Alternatively, you can use a deep fryer set to 365 F.

  • Separate large onion (1) slices into rings and set aside.

  • In a wide-mouthed bowl, combine whey protein (1 cup), xanthan gum (2 teaspoon), salt (1 1/2 teaspoon), baking powder (2 teaspoon), and grated parmesan (1/2 cup).

  • Add soda water (6 tablespoons) and whisked egg (1), and stir until well combined. The combo will be wet.

  • Once the oil is hot (about 375 F), use tongs to transfer the onion rings into the coating, then directly in the oil.

  • Allow the onion rings to fry until golden, then transfer them to a paper towel-lined plate. Continue until you've fried all the onions rings.

  • Serve immediately (will get soggy over time) and enjoy!

Lindsey's Tips

  • Frying Oil should have a high smoke point and mild flavor. Please keep in mind that all oils are low in carbs, but some are considered "healthier" based on polyunsaturated fats. If this is a concern to you, opt for avocado oil, or peanut oil (slightly higher). If not, vegetable or canola are great frying oils. I use peanut oil for frying.
  • Xanthan Gum is necessary for binding the ingredients of this recipe together, you CAN'T SKIP OR SUB!
